THE GLUCOSE AND FRUCTOSE CONTENT OF FRUITS AND VEGETABLES ...
Fresh vegetables naturally contain minimal glucose and fructose. Unprocessed vegetables have a range of fructose and glucose content between 0.1 g and 1.5 g per 100 g portion. Fresh broccoli and avocado have the lowest amounts, with about 0.1 g glucose and fructose in 100 g. White cabbage has 1.5 g fructose and 1.9 g glucose when boiled.

LIST OF SUGARY VEGETABLES | HEALTHY EATING | SF GATE
Dec 06, 2018 · Peas are another sugary vegetable, with 9.5 grams of sugar and 8.8 grams of fiber in each 1-cup serving of boiled green peas. These nutritious vegetables also provide you with significant amounts of iron, magnesium, phosphorus, potassium, folate, niacin, riboflavin, thiamine and vitamins A, B-6, C and K. HOW TO FERMENT VEGETABLES | EVERYTHING YOU NEED TO KNOW
Fermented vegetables begin with lacto-fermentation, a method of food preservation that also enhances the nutrient content of the food. The action of the bacteria makes the minerals in cultured foods more readily available to the body. The bacteria also produce vitamins and enzymes that are beneficial for digestion.
